I have a 98 Maxima SE with only 15k miles. The last couple of months on and off I have had trouble starting my car after I have let it sit there for a while, usually overnight. The engine will sound like it starts and then after 2 seconds or less the rpm's drop and the engine stalls. I have seen a few post on the news groups with other owners having the same problem. They said the dealer needed to adjust the idle speed controller. Is this something that is under warranty? Thanks for your help!

Try this experiment. With the engine cold, turn the key to "on", wait ten
seconds, and then turn the key to "start". That delay gives the fuel pump
some extra time to build up pressure in the fuel rail. If the engine fires
readily and runs normally after this brief delay, there may be a problem
with fuel pressure (weak pump, leaky check valve).

I was having the same problem with my 2000 SE with approx. 50k miles on it--My mechanic thought it might be the air intake valve, but wanted to try cleaning out the system, etc. before doing it- after further tests (cleaning would work for a little while), it turned out to be the engine controller. My guys took it to a Nissan dealership and they did fix it under warranty (I didn't think I still had a warranty on it,...bought the car from someone in NJ). I just got it back last night, but so far, so good. I have no idea what the cost would be if it wasn't under warranty. Hope this info helps some.
